Asbestos is a mineral that occurs naturally that was once widely used in building and construction materials. It was affordable, durable, and fire-resistant. It was found to be extremely hazardous and linked to many serious conditions such as mesothelioma and asbestosis. The people who were exposed to asbestos in high-risk occupations such as mechanics, construction workers, and shipyard workers are at greater risk of developing these diseases.

New York Asbestos Lawyers

New York is among the most active states in the country for asbestos litigation. Hundreds of asbestos lawsuits are filed across the state every year. These lawsuits are often filed by people suffering from asbestos-related diseases, such as m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ases. These lawsuits are typically filed against companies that exposed workers to asbestos in the workplace. An experienced mesothelioma lawyer can help those suffering from mesothelioma and their families seek compensation for their loss.

The mesothelioma lawyers at the firm Weitz & Luxenberg helped dozens clients in New York get compensation for their losses. They operate on a contingency basis, which means they do not get paid unless they obtain an award or settlement for their client. The lawyers are well-versed in federal asbestos attorneys laws as well as New York statutes. They are also well-versed in the different types of mesothelioma lawsuits that need to be filed.

Many thousands of patients have been diagnosed with mesothelioma in the New York area alone. Many of these patients were exposed to asbestos while working in construction, shipyards, and auto manufacturing industries. People who have contracted an asbestos-related illness often have to undergo extensive medical treatments. The compensation from mesothelioma lawsuits that are successful will help pay for these treatments.

In addition to filing a legal claim against the asbestos companies who are negligent An asbestos lawyer can help someone file a workers' compensation claim as well as a personal injury or wrongful death lawsuit. Workers' compensation may seem like the most obvious option if exposure to asbestos occurred on an employment site however, the benefits are not able to cover the full costs of the losses suffered by a victim.

New York mesothelioma patients should contact a New York mesothelioma lawyer who can provide free consultations and representation in their case. During the meeting, an attorney will explain to the victim the legal options available and answer any questions they have. They also will go over the time frame within which they must bring a lawsuit, which is known as the statute of limitations. In New York, the statute of limitations is usually two years from the date of death of a loved one or three years from the date of the diagnosis.
